Core Practices (2026)

1. **Table-driven tests are the idiom.** Define a slice of cases, loop, and run each as a subtest with `t.Run(tc.name, …)` for isolation and readable output. 2. **`testify` is the de-facto assertion/mock standard.** `assert` for soft checks, `require` to abort on failure, `mock` for hand-written mocks, `suite` for setup/teardown groups. It is maintained at v1 (no breaking v2). Source: https://pkg.go.dev/github.com/stretchr/testify 3. **Fuzzing is native** since Go 1.18 (`func FuzzXxx(f *testing.F)`), and finds edge cases table tests miss. 4. **Always run `-race` in CI.** The race detector catches data races that are otherwise nondeterministic and unreproducible. 5. **Measure before optimizing.** Benchmarks (`go test -bench`) + pprof profiles guide real changes; PGO feeds a production profile back into the compiler.

Workflow

1. **Explore** the code under test and existing test conventions first. 2. **Write table-driven tests** as the default shape ([table-driven.md](references/table-driven.md)). 3. **Add testify** assertions/mocks where they improve readability, not reflexively. 4. **Run** `go test ./... -race -cover` and inspect gaps. 5. **Fuzz / benchmark** hotspots and parsers ([fuzzing-benchmarks.md](references/fuzzing-benchmarks.md)). 6. **Profile** only after a benchmark proves a hotspot ([coverage-profiling.md](references/coverage-profiling.md)). 7. **Validate** with sniper after changes.
